
Oat Milk
This creamy and delicious oat milk is the perfect non-dairy alternative to cow's milk. It's easy to make at home and can be used in a variety of recipes.
Instructions
- 1
Place the rolled oats in a blender.
- 2
Add salt to taste. For sweetness, add the vanilla extract and/or the pitted dates, if you’d like.
- 3
Add the water and blend on high for 1 minute.
- 4
Double strain the liquid into a medium-sized container using a cheesecloth-lined strainer.
- 5
Serve immediately or refrigerate in a sealed container for up to 3 days.
- 6
Enjoy!

Ingredients (5)
- •1 cup rolled oats
- •Salt, to taste
- •1 teaspoon vanilla extract, optional
- •2 dates, pitted, optional
- •4 cups water
